The effect of degreasing treatments on the passivity of pure aluminum sheets 99.99 mass%.for electrolytic capacitor
electrodes has been investigated in terms of surface oxide film characteristics. The polarization resistance Rp.measured by
AC impedance measurement in 1 N HCl was dependent on the conditions of degreasing treatments e.g., organic solvent,
alkaline cleaner.. The XPS measurement for O1s binding energy and the SIMS measurement for the secondary ion intensity
of AlOq revealed that degreasing treatments effect the composition at the surface of oxide film. NaOH solution and alkaline
cleaner caused a number of –OH sites to increase. In addition, there was an inverse relationship between the logarithm of the
relative intensity of AlOq and the Epit pitting potential.in 3.5% NaCl. Therefore it is considered that the great number of
–OH sites at the surface due to degreasing treatments, through which Cly ions can penetrate, have the larger effect on the
passivity of pure aluminum sheets. q1999 Elsevier Science B.V. All rights reserved
